Up close and personal picture. A Bison decided to take a stroll on the West Yellowstone road, there was a long stretch of traffic slowly moving. Finally, a trooper came, then the bison decided to move over.

Tonight, we walked to Our Lady of the Pines for mass. The priest told the story of a lady who had 4 boys; all of them went to war. She said if all of her boys returned from the war, she would build a church in West Yellowstone. And, she did with the help of her boys. Two of them became engineers.
